Output 18d4eb31dbe571cda3c51a1ebf29a04fc707a034da45247f3dc46b9e1c627718:0

value
443322655
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 926fa30f2c80292212282b66279f0aefba07c319 OP_EQUALVERIFY OP_CHECKSIG
address
1EMHPgMaTq9sDiHfPvjNxp1qH4amZhU9NC
transaction
18d4eb31dbe571cda3c51a1ebf29a04fc707a034da45247f3dc46b9e1c627718
spent
true